In Generating Stations Why The Generation Of ELECTRICITY Is In 3 Phase Form??
OR
In Generating Station Why We Generates The ELECTRICITY In The 3 Phase??
Why Not In The 4 Phase,
5 Phase Or 6 Phase Form??
Answer Posted / murali290
as phases increases the power handling capability
increases.so,compared to 1-ph&2-ph ,3-ph has more power
handling capacity.
but more than 3-ph has following problems even high
power handling capability
1:as no.of phases increases wounding of winding in
generator ,transformer becomes complex.
2:providing of heat sinks coplex
3:in transmission more length cross arms & heavy
supporters are required.
etc...........
by considering all above things we prefered 3-ph
system.
